An intuitive and easy-to-use Subtractive Rapid Prototyping (SRP) device, the small footprint MDX-40A fits into any Fab Lab, workshop, office or classroom and allows both novice and advanced users to create precision 3D models. Built for designers, engineers and students who work in fast-paced environments, the speed, versatility and convenience of the MDX-40A put you in complete control.

The Modela MDX-40A Benchtop CNC Mill allows you to create 3D prototypes from non-proprietary materials, including plastics, woods, ABS, delrin, nylon, acrylic, tooling board and more. Open up endless industrial and creative applications, such as:

  • Product prototypes
  • Snap-fit parts
  • Toys and figurines
  • 3D art and sculpture
  • Replacement parts
  • 3D molds and stamps
  • Electrical casings
  • Plaques and engravings

Specifications

MODEL MDX-40A
Acceptable materials Resins such as chemical wood and modeling wax (metal not supported)
X, Y, and Z strokes 12 (X) x 12 (Y) x 4-1/8 (Z) in.
(305 (X) x 305 (Y) x 105 (Z) mm)
Distance from spindle tip to table Maximum 123 mm (4-13/16 in.)
Table size 12 (W) x 12 (D) in.
(305 (W) x 305 (D) mm)
Loadable workpiece weight 8.8 lb (4 kg)
XYZ-axis motor Stepping motor
Feed rate XY-axis: 0.0039 to 1.9 in./s (0.1 to 50 mm/sec.),
Z-axis: 0.0039 to 1.1 in./s (0.1 to 30 mm/sec.)
Software resolution NC-code: 0.000039 in./step (0.001mm/step),
RML-1: 0.00039 in./step (0.01 mm/step)(RML-1)
Mechanical resolution 0.00008 in./step (0.002 mm/step)(Micro-step)
Spindle motor Brushless DC motor, Maximum 100 W
Spindle rotation 4500 to 15000 rpm
Tool chuck Collet
Interface USB (compliant with Universal Serial Bus Specification Revision 1.1)
Power supply Voltage and frequency AC100 to 240 +/-10%, 50/60 Hz
Required power capacity 2.1 A
Power consumption Approx. 210W
Acoustic noise level No-load operation: 56 dB (A) or less, Standby: 42 dB (A) or less
Dimensions 26-3/8 (W) x 29-15/16 (D) x 21-13/16 (H) in.
669 (W) x 760 (D) x 554 (H) mm
Weight 143.3 lb (65 kg)
Operation temperature 41 to 104°F (5 to 40°C)
Operation humidity 35 to 80% (no condensation)
Included items Power cord, power plug adapter, USB cable, collet, Z0 sensor, hexagonal wrench, hexagonal screw drivers, spanners, Roland

Optional Rotary Axis Unit (ZCL-40A)
Maximum angle of rotation +/-18 x 105° (+/-5000 rotations)
Maximum loadable workpiece size* 4.7 in.(120 mm) diameter by 10.6 in. (270 mm) long
Maximum thickness holdable by workpiece clamp 0.4 to 1.8 in. (10 to 45 mm)
Loadable workpiece weight 2.2 lb (1kg ) (including clamps)
Feed rate 0.23-11.79 rpm
Mechanical resolution 0.005625 deg./step (Micro-step)
Dimensions 18.5 (W) x 11.3 (D) x 4.5 (H) in.
(470 (W) x 286 (D) x 115 (H) mm)
Weight 16.5 lb (7.5 kg)
Included items Y-origin sensors (large and small), Z-origin sensor, Y-origin detection pin, center drill, live center, hexagonal wrench, cap

*The range that can actually be cut is limited by the amount of tool extention and interference between the loaded workpiece

Optional 3D Scanning Sensor Unit (ZSC-1)
Maximum scanning area 12.0 (X) x 12.0 (Y) x 2.3 (Z) in.
(305 (X) x 305 (Y) x 60 (Z) mm)
Distance from probe tip to table Maximum 3.6 in. (92.4 mm)
Table load capacity Maximum 8.8 lb (4 kg)
Sensor Type Roland Active Piezo Sensor (RAPS)
Effective Probe Length 2-5/16 in. (60 mm)
Tip Bulb Radius 0.00315 in. (0.08 mm)
Minimum scan pitch .002 in (.051 mm)
Scanning method Contacting, mesh-point height-sensing
Operating speed XY-axis 0.6 to 1.1 in./s (15 to 30 mm/sec.)
Z-axis 0.04 to 1.1 in./s (1 to 30 mm/sec.)
